Minute Maid Park is a baseball stadium in Houston, spectacular in all its might. It is the home of the Houston Astros - an iconic site for baseball fans all over the world.

Since its inception in 2000, the park has been a popular destination for sports enthusiasts. It has a striking and inventive exterior, including a retractable roof with the facility of open-close, depending on the weather. This feature allows games to be played even in severe weather, making it a viable option for the Astros' home field.

The stadium is particularly notable for its one-of-a-kind features, including the train that goes along the left field wall after an Astros player scores a home run. This eccentric touch enhances the stadium's appeal and generates an exciting atmosphere for supporters. Minute Maid Park, Houston: A Home Run in the Heart of Texas

Minute Maid Park stands out for its innovative retractable roof, allowing games to be played rain or shine, and its charming old-fashioned features, including a vintage locomotive and a manually operated scoreboard. As one of Major League Baseball's most storied franchises, the Houston Astros have a proud history of success, including winning their first World Series in 2017.

Q. What is Minute Maid Park?

A: Minute Maid Park is a baseball park located in Houston, Texas. It is the home of the Houston Astros, a Major League Baseball team. The park opened in 2000 and is named after Minute Maid, a brand of orange juice.
